Tom Clancy’s Rainbow Six: Siege – Update 1.3 Is Now Available On The PC

Ubisoft has released a new update for the PC version of Tom Clancy’s Rainbow Six: Siege. According to its release notes, this update further improves the game’s cheating countermeasures, adds a configuration that allows to turn on insta-kill for Defenders that go outside their zone during the preparation phase, fixes a bug that allowed players to exit their zone during the preparation phase, and comes with various online fixes. Dome City – Story-oriented Sci-Fi Adventure Powered By Unreal Engine 4 – First Gameplay Trailer

Overon Station has released the first gameplay trailer of their mysterious sci-fi adventure, Dome City. Dome City is a story-oriented sci-fi adventure game in first person view where choice actually matters. You’re the leader of three young space cadets stuck in an abandoned yet haunted city on Mars. Homefront: The Revolution Is Officially Coming On May 17th, Gets New Trailer

Last week, we informed you about the possible release date for Homefront: The Revolution. And it appears that this rumour was legit. Deep Silver confirmed today that its open-world FPS will be released on May 17th. In order to celebrate this announcement, Deep Silver released a new trailer that can be viewed below. Enjoy!
